1. The data_exchange.req telegram is sent to XPS-E. XPS-E has already
received the first characters at the interface. It returns them in the
response telegram data_exchange.res to the Master. The confirmation
is incremented by 1 and the length of the reception data is entered.
Moreover, the status (S) of XPS-E is returned.
¬
2. New data_exchange.req telegram.XPS-E returns the new data by
incrementing the confirmation number by 1.
¬
3. As response telegram to the data_exchange.req telegram, XPS/XPS-E
enters the old confirmation number as no new data has been received
at the serial interface. The receive data length is set to 0.
¬
4. XPS-E has again received new data. The confirmation number is
incremented by one and the data returned correspondingly by the
data_exchange.res telegram to the Master.
¬
If no time guarantee can be given and if data loss has to be excluded
under all circumstances, XPS-E must be run in the request mode.
Serial triggered Mode
In serial triggered mode XPS/XPS-E waits for the termination of the
receive data by the trigger character defined within the external user
parameters of XPS-E (usually LF in ASCII-strings). The receive
confirmation number is not increased as long as no trigger character
is received. After the trigger character is received the Data Exchange
Resp.-buffer is updated with the received data inclusive the trigger
character. The data Exchange Resp.-buffer does not change as long
as the next trigger character is received.
